Egypt Sends Sudan 2 Planes Carrying Bread Production Lines


Thu 01 Oct 2020 | 11:32 PM
Nawal Sayed

Upon directives of President Abdel Fattah El Sisi, Supreme Commander of the Armed Forces, Egypt keeps supporting the sisterly Republic of Sudan so as to confront the flash floods that have ravaged it recently.

Two military transport planes took off on Thursday from East Cairo Air Base heading to Khartoum International Airport in the Republic of Sudan, carrying a number of field bread production lines provided by Cairo to Khartoum, in order to lift the burden on the Sudanese citizens in their recent crisis.

On their part, a number of Sudanese officials who received the two planes affirmed their deep thanks and gratitude for the relentless Egyptian efforts and its continuous support to Sudan throughout the crisis period, and over the long history of solid relations between the two countries.
